The Lagos state command of the National Drug
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) has discovered
a methamphetamine lab in a residential building in
Ago Palace Way, Okota, Lagos.
Mr Chijioke, the Chief Executive Officer of Best
Fellows Nigeria Limited, was arrested during the
raid on the building, where meth was being
produced.
According to the NDLEA Lagos State commander,
Mr. Aliyu Sule, who made the disclosures on
Thursday, January 8, 7.6kg of methamphetamine,
nine drums of Toluene, a Toyota 4 Runner, a
Toyota Hiace bus and a pressure pot were
recovered from the laboratory in the building.
In his statement, Chijioke, stated that he was
introduced into the hard drugs business by a
friend.
The suspect said: “I only attended primary and
secondary schools before I went into trading. A
friend introduced me to the business of chemical
importation from China and Europe in 2012.
“A year later, I learned how to produce
methamphetamine because there is high profit in
it. I began to produce methamphetamine in my
house in 2013. My first production was bad
because of inexperience. Gradually, I was able to
perfect the process. That was how I got involved
in the drug business,” Chijioke added.
